This scheme is described by the RFC6750.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own. Follow this guide to set up the generation and structure of these tokens. Token is created only once and used in all subsequent request until user logoff. Include the ID token in an Authorization: Bearer ID_TOKEN header in the request to the receiving service.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used We will need to install the python-dotenv library. Java. The C#/.NET code was automatically generated for the POST JSON Bearer Token Authorization Header example. Assume have a .env file with some random API Token. Under root folder of the solution, create a class TokenProvider.cs. Before Authorization: key=AIzaSyZ-1u0GBYzPu7Udno5aA Python def _get_access_token(): """Retrieve a valid access token that can be used to authorize requests. With the use of lsof, is seems that the file remains open, or at least, this is how I interpret the following results.Before, running the open there is no record in lsof table about the filename.Then after the open is executed, multiple records appear with read access. search. In this Curl Request With Bearer Token Authorization Header example, we send a request to the ReqBin echo URL. ; requestType returns additional details for each request type. Accessing your API Key & Secret; Generating JWTs; Testing with JWTs When deploying using the Python SDK v2, use the OnlineEndpoint class. NOTE: We still need to check if a token is blacklisted. Click Run to execute the Curl Bearer Token Authorization Header request online and see the results. For an example application, see Open Banking Brazil - Authorization Samples on GitHub. The Bearer Token is a string with no meaning or uses but becomes important within a proper tokenization system. An access token is like a ticket which has got a time lifespan. Pass the access_token value in the Authorization header of requests each time your app calls an API. Note that you need to specify your own access token: GET /drive/v2/files HTTP/1.1 Host: www.googleapis.com Authorization: Bearer access_token In the Python sample, the code that calls Microsoft Graph is in app.py#L53-L62. Under root folder of the solution, create a class TokenProvider.cs. 'Bearer ' header and you must be in a Contributor or Owner role on the workspace resource in Azure. So, if the token is valid and not expired, we get the user id from the tokens payload, which is then used to get the user data from the database. For more information, see How to deploy an online endpoint. Authorization: Bearer 9e0cd62a22f451701f29c3bde214 A multi-value parameter indicating which properties of the customer request to expand, where: serviceDesk returns additional details for each service desk. Then, after setting the authorization header, it calls the web API. To send a GET request with a Bearer Token authorization header using Python, you need to make an HTTP GET request and provide your Bearer Token with the Authorization: Bearer {token} HTTP header. search. An access token is like a ticket which has got a time lifespan. Make sure to add: ; participant returns the participant details, if any, for each customer request. GETURLURLheader"Authorization": "Bearer "header This tutorial will help you call your own API using the Authorization Code Flow. To get an Azure AD access token, you can use either the: Authorization code flow (interactive) for example python get-tokens.py 12a34b56-789c-0d12-e3fa-b456789c0123 a1bc2d34-5e67-8f89-01ab-c2345d6c78de. Click Run to execute the Curl Bearer Token Authorization Header request online and see the results.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used To send a GET request with a Bearer Token authorization header using C#/.NET, you need to make an HTTP GET request and provide your Bearer Token with the Authorization: Bearer {token} HTTP header. This code is something you can actually use in your application, save the password hashes in your database, etc. pip install python-dotenv. Python. To integrate with the Flipkart Marketplace Seller APIs provided in this documentation, you could go through this API documentation and create your own application. These are the repository's commits. Enabling this will set the Access-Control-Allow-Origin header to the Origin header if it is found in the list, and the Access-Control-Allow-Headers header to Origin, Accept, X-Requested-With, Content-type, Authorization.You must provide the exact Origin, i.e., https://www.home-assistant.io will allow requests from So, if the token is valid and not expired, we get the user id from the tokens payload, which is then used to get the user data from the database. After executing the requests.post, the records are still there indicating that the file did not close. POST Requests With urllib.request. Then, after setting the authorization header, it calls the web API. A list of origin domain names to allow CORS requests from. Token is created only once and used in all subsequent request until user logoff. OAuth 2.0 Client Library for Python; OAuth 2.0 Client Library for Ruby.NET. Note that you need to specify your own access token: GET /drive/v2/files HTTP/1.1 Host: www.googleapis.com Authorization: Bearer access_token search. oauth2Token = oauth_client. B Accessing your API Key & Secret; Generating JWTs; Testing with JWTs The default value is key. Token is created only once and used in all subsequent request until user logoff.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own. On This Page . Step 2. Otherwise, log in and go to Account > API Access to generate a new API token. Much of authentication comes down to understanding the specific protocol that the target server uses and reading the documentation closely to get it working. Now that we have all the security flow, let's make the application actually secure, using JWT tokens and secure password hashing.. A list of origin domain names to allow CORS requests from. For an example application, see Open Banking Brazil - Authorization Samples on GitHub. 'Bearer ' header and you must be in a Contributor or Owner role on the workspace resource in Azure. OAuth 2.0 Client Library for Python; OAuth 2.0 Client Library for Ruby.NET. An access token is like a ticket which has got a time lifespan. For security reasons, the bearer token should only be sent over HTTPS connections. The Bearer Token is a string with no meaning or uses but becomes important within a proper tokenization system. A multi-value parameter indicating which properties of the customer request to expand, where: serviceDesk returns additional details for each service desk. They are paginated and returned in reverse chronological order, similar to the output of git log. GETURLURLheader"Authorization": "Bearer "header Accessing for the first time with kubectl When accessing the Kubernetes API for the first time, we suggest using the Kubernetes CLI, kubectl. To send a GET request with a Bearer Token authorization header using C#/.NET, you need to make an HTTP GET request and provide your Bearer Token with the Authorization: Bearer {token} HTTP header. POST Requests With urllib.request. Get an Azure AD access token. Depending on the implementation of the OAuth2 provider, the authorization header type could be Token or Bearer. Bitbucket Cloud REST API integrations, and Atlassian Connect for Bitbucket add-ons, can use OAuth 2.0 to access resources in Bitbucket.. OAuth 2.0. ; requestType returns additional details for each request type. Accessing for the first time with kubectl When accessing the Kubernetes API for the first time, we suggest using the Kubernetes CLI, kubectl. This bearer token can then be used for a period of time with bearer authentication. For more information, see How to deploy an online endpoint. The C#/.NET code was automatically generated for the POST JSON Bearer Token Authorization Header example. API_TOKEN = "SOME API TOKEN" Lets try reading the API Token in Python. We will need to install the python-dotenv library. The code attempts to get a token from the token cache. When deploying using the Python SDK v2, use the OnlineEndpoint class. Python . They show you how to use Universal Login and Auth0's language- and framework-specific SDKs.. A token-based Lambda authorizer (also called a TOKEN authorizer) receives the caller's identity in a bearer token, such as a JSON Web Token (JWT) or an OAuth token. A token-based Lambda authorizer (also called a TOKEN authorizer) receives the caller's identity in a bearer token, such as a JSON Web Token (JWT) or an OAuth token. Get an Azure AD access token. Otherwise, log in and go to Account > API Access to generate a new API token. For security reasons, bearer tokens are only sent over HTTPS (SSL). A request parameter-based Lambda authorizer (also called a REQUEST authorizer) receives the caller's identity in a combination of The server informs the client that it has returned JSON with a 'Content-Type: application/json' response header. Typically, this is automatically set-up when you work through a Getting Python . The API guidance states that a bearer token must be generated to allow calls to the API, which I have done successfully. To send a GET request with a Bearer Token authorization header using Java, you need to make an HTTP GET request and provide your Bearer Token with the Authorization: Bearer {token} HTTP header. The Auth0 Authentication API is a reference for those who prefer to write code independently. Depending on the implementation of the OAuth2 provider, the authorization header type could be Token or Bearer. Node.js. In this Curl Request With Bearer Token Authorization Header example, we send a request to the ReqBin echo URL. The Azure AD resource URI of the resource for which a token should be obtained. Java. Follow this guide to set up the generation and structure of these tokens. Much of authentication comes down to understanding the specific protocol that the target server uses and reading the documentation closely to get it working. The C#/.NET code was automatically generated for the POST JSON Bearer Token Authorization Header example. Once the Access Token has been obtained it can be used to make calls to the API by passing it as a Bearer Token in the Authorization header of the HTTP request. Note that Resource Owner Password Credentials Grant (4.3) is no longer Node.js. The Azure AD resource URI of the resource for which a token should be obtained. The best HTTP header for your client to send an access token (JWT or any other token) is the Authorization header with the Bearer authentication scheme. They show you how to use Universal Login and Auth0's language- and framework-specific SDKs.. The resource could be one of the Azure services that support Azure AD authentication or any other resource URI.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own. 'Bearer ' header and you must be in a Contributor or Owner role on the workspace resource in Azure. Make sure to add: This code is something you can actually use in your application, save the password hashes in your database, etc. To send a GET request with a Bearer Token authorization header using Java, you need to make an HTTP GET request and provide your Bearer Token with the Authorization: Bearer {token} HTTP header. With the use of lsof, is seems that the file remains open, or at least, this is how I interpret the following results.Before, running the open there is no record in lsof table about the filename.Then after the open is executed, multiple records appear with read access. If you want to learn how the flow works and why you should use it, see Authorization Code Flow.If you want to learn to add login to your regular web app, see Add Login Using the Authorization Code Flow. This bearer token can then be used for a period of time with bearer authentication.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own. Python. ; participant returns the participant details, if any, for each customer request. In the Python sample, the code that calls Microsoft Graph is in app.py#L53-L62. A multi-value parameter indicating which properties of the customer request to expand, where: serviceDesk returns additional details for each service desk. Bearer Token. If it can't get a token, it signs the user in again. Enabling this will set the Access-Control-Allow-Origin header to the Origin header if it is found in the list, and the Access-Control-Allow-Headers header to Origin, Accept, X-Requested-With, Content-type, Authorization.You must provide the exact Origin, i.e., https://www.home-assistant.io will allow requests from Depending on the implementation of the OAuth2 provider, the authorization header type could be Token or Bearer. The easiest and most reliable way to manage this process is to use the authentication libraries, as shown below, to generate and use this token. They are paginated and returned in reverse chronological order, similar to the output of git log. API_TOKEN = "SOME API TOKEN" Lets try reading the API Token in Python. This topic discusses multiple ways to interact with clusters. After executing the requests.post, the records are still there indicating that the file did not close. TaxJar expects the API key to be included in all API requests to the server using a header like the following: Authorization: Token token="9e0cd62a22f451701f29c3bde214" or. PHP. Python auth/service-to-service/auth.py View on GitHub Feedback. Get the key or token The code attempts to get a token from the token cache. oauth2Token = oauth_client. First, identify which flow to use. Bearer Authentication (also called token authentication) is an HTTP authentication scheme created as part of OAuth 2.0 but is now used on its own.

What Is The Strongest Quirk In My Hero Academia, Case Interview Assumptions, Hove Greyhound Trials, Maximum Likelihood Estimation Code Python, Senior Program Manager Meta Salary, How To Run Jar File In Unix Shell Script, Consanguineal Family Definition,

python get bearer token from header

Menu